Centrifugal Casting Steel Pipes Market Size

The global centrifugal casting steel pipes market size is valued at USD 9.8 billion in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 13.6 billion by 2030, growing with a CAGR of 6.8% during the forecast period (2025–2030).

The Centrifugal Casting Steel Pipes Market encompasses the global trade, production, and application of steel pipes manufactured through the centrifugal casting process. These pipes are widely used in industries such as petrochemicals, water and wastewater treatment, energy, and construction due to their high precision, durability, metallurgical uniformity, and superior mechanical properties. Centrifugal Casting Steel Pipes Market Growth Factors

The centrifugal casting steel pipes market is primarily driven by the increasing demand for high-strength and corrosion-resistant pipes in oil & gas, energy, and wastewater management industries. The growth in urban infrastructure and industrialization, particularly in developing economies, has fueled the use of steel pipes for large-scale pipeline projects. Additionally, the precision and cost-efficiency offered by centrifugal casting compared to other casting methods have made it the preferred choice for producing thick-walled and high-diameter steel pipes. For example, the increased drilling activities in offshore oilfields require robust steel piping capable of withstanding extreme pressure, a specification efficiently met by centrifugal casting technology.

Restraining Factor

Despite strong growth potential, the market faces restraints such as high initial setup costs associated with centrifugal casting machinery, skilled labor requirements, and limited awareness in developing markets. Moreover, supply chain disruptions caused by geopolitical instability and trade restrictions on steel exports can significantly affect the pricing and availability of raw materials like stainless steel billets and carbon steel. Environmental regulations on steel production, especially in Europe and parts of Asia, could also slow down market growth.

Market Opportunity

Emerging applications in the renewable energy sector and nuclear power projects are opening new avenues for centrifugal cast steel pipes. There is also a growing opportunity in the replacement of aging pipeline infrastructure in North America and Europe. Technological innovations like hybrid centrifugal casting techniques (integrating horizontal and vertical casting) and advancements in metallurgical processes are expected to enhance product quality and customization, offering manufacturers a competitive edge.

Market Trends

A significant trend is the integration of digital manufacturing technologies such as automated process monitoring and AI-based quality assurance in centrifugal casting operations. Sustainability is also becoming a core trend, with companies exploring low-emission steel manufacturing and recycling of scrap metals. Furthermore, the market is witnessing a shift toward customized, high-alloy steel pipes for specialized applications such as chemical transport and high-temperature fluid systems.

Product Type Insights

The centrifugal casting steel pipes market is divided into stainless steel, carbon steel, and alloy steel centrifugal pipes. Stainless steel centrifugal pipes are expected to lead the market with an estimated size of USD 4.1 billion in 2025 and a projected CAGR of 7.2% through 2030. Their widespread use in chemical processing, water treatment, and pharmaceutical sectors is driven by their excellent corrosion resistance. Moreover, their adoption is growing in hygienic and food-grade applications, particularly in regions emphasizing sanitary standards and clean manufacturing environments. Carbon steel centrifugal pipes, valued at USD 3.5 billion in 2025, are projected to grow at a CAGR of 6.3%. These pipes are preferred in structural and heavy industrial applications due to their lower cost and high mechanical strength, making them especially suitable for infrastructure-heavy regions undergoing large-scale development. Meanwhile, alloy steel centrifugal pipes, with a 2025 market valuation of USD 2.2 billion and a CAGR of 6.9%, are gaining traction in power generation, defense, and high-temperature environments due to their strength under thermal stress and pressure variations.

Application Insights

The oil and gas industry holds the largest market share, accounting for 34% in 2025. The rapid expansion of oil exploration activities and the increasing need for robust and corrosion-resistant transport pipelines are fueling demand for centrifugal steel pipes. The power generation sector follows with a 22% share, driven by rising investments in thermal and nuclear power plants, which require durable high-temperature piping systems. The water and wastewater management segment, capturing 18% of the market, is benefiting from global initiatives to upgrade water infrastructure and implement smart water grids. The chemical and petrochemical industry represents 14% of the market, propelled by the rising need for high-performance pipes capable of handling corrosive and high-pressure fluids. The remaining 12% is held by other industries such as construction, marine, and automotive, where growing infrastructure development in emerging economies continues to support steady demand for centrifugal casting steel pipes.

Regional Insights

In North America, the market is projected to reach USD 2.4 billion by 2025, growing at a CAGR of 6.1% through 2030. The United States is the dominant contributor, driven by large-scale shale gas extraction activities and the urgent need to replace aging pipeline infrastructure. Canada also presents substantial growth opportunities, especially with its national emphasis on clean energy and support from the U.S. Department of Energy’s pipeline modernization initiatives, which collectively foster long-term market expansion.

Europe Centrifugal Casting Steel Pipes Market Trends

In Europe, the market is expected to be valued at USD 2.1 billion in 2025, with a CAGR of 5.8%. Countries like Germany, France, and the UK are key markets owing to their industrial maturity and advanced infrastructure. Strict environmental regulations in the region are accelerating the shift toward recyclable and long-lasting piping solutions. Additionally, Europe’s commitment to cross-border energy integration and smart utility projects is increasing the demand for high-performance steel piping systems.

The Asia-Pacific region leads in overall market size, with an estimated value of USD 3.2 billion in 2025 and the highest regional CAGR of 8.2%. This growth is largely attributed to rapid urbanization, expanding industrial bases, and rising investments in water treatment and transport infrastructure across China, India, and Japan. Strategic initiatives such as China’s Belt and Road Initiative and India’s Smart Cities Mission are playing a pivotal role in enhancing regional infrastructure, thereby fueling demand for centrifugal steel pipes.

In Latin America, the market is poised to reach USD 1.1 billion by 2025, expanding at a CAGR of 7.4%. Brazil and Mexico are the primary contributors due to renewed focus on oil exploration, government-led energy reforms, and substantial infrastructure development. Foreign direct investment in mining and public utilities is further supporting the region’s upward trajectory.

The Middle East & Africa market is projected to grow to USD 1.0 billion in 2025, with a CAGR of 7.1%. This region benefits from abundant oil reserves and a strategic push toward infrastructure diversification. Countries such as the UAE and Saudi Arabia are investing heavily in desalination plants and wastewater treatment facilities, which are key application areas for stainless steel centrifugal pipes. Meanwhile, South Africa’s urban renewal and utility upgrade programs are also contributing to steady regional growth.

Recent Developments

  • October 2023: Dandong Foundry Co. expanded its vertical centrifugal casting plant in China, increasing production capacity by 25%.
  • May 2024: Sandvik AB launched a new high-temperature alloy pipe line with enhanced mechanical durability for nuclear reactor applications.
  • February 2025: American Cast Iron Pipe Company (ACIPCO) entered a strategic partnership with a Saudi infrastructure firm to localize pipe production for large-scale water projects.
  • August 2024: Hitachi Metals introduced an AI-powered defect detection system for centrifugal pipe inspection, reducing quality issues by 30%.
